
In Milwaukee, renting a mini excavator for foundation repair in 2026 typically costs between $200 and $400 per day, $800 to $1,500 per week, and $2,500 to $4,000 per month. These rates vary based on the model, size, and additional attachments required. Leading rental companies in Milwaukee provide a range of options suitable for different project needs.

Several factors affect the rental costs of mini excavators in Milwaukee. The equipment's size and power, the duration of the rental, and the specific attachments needed can all influence the price. Additionally, seasonal demand and availability may impact rates.
When renting a mini excavator, be aware of potential hidden fees. These can include delivery and pick-up charges, which may be flat or mileage-based, fuel or recharge surcharges, and damage waivers versus full insurance. Cleaning fees for concrete or mud, late-return penalties, and overtime hours can also add to the total cost.

When planning a mini excavator rental for foundation repair in Milwaukee, consider the specific needs of your project. Foundation repair often requires precise digging and maneuvering in tight spaces, so ensure the excavator is equipped with the right attachments. Plan for delivery and pickup logistics, especially in urban areas where access might be restricted. Rental duration should align with your project timeline to avoid unnecessary extensions, and ensure the equipment is returned in clean condition to prevent additional fees.
Tip: Schedule your rental return early in the day to allow time for any necessary cleaning or adjustments before the deadline.
